Developing a Winning Sales Mindset

Developing a winning sales mindset involves embracing the notion that selling isn’t just a profession, it’s a way of life. It’s about persuading others to buy into your ideas, whether you’re selling a product, a concept, or your own potential. It’s about being passionate about what you’re selling, believing in its value, and conveying that passion and belief to others. The Importance of Personal Branding

Personal branding is emphasized as a critical element in the pursuit of success. The concept is not merely about presenting a curated image to the world, but rather about authentic self-expression. It revolves around identifying your unique strengths, passions, and values, then showcasing them in a manner that is both genuine and appealing to others. Mastering the Art of Selling

Mastering the art of selling is about understanding your client’s needs, establishing trust, and presenting your product or service as the solution to their problem. It involves the mastery of communication, the ability to listen, and the power of persuasion. It is important to remember that the most successful sales are based on relationships, not transactions. Building and Leveraging Relationships

Building relationships is about more than just making connections with people. It’s about understanding their needs, desires and concerns, and being able to offer solutions that address these areas. It’s about being able to demonstrate empathy, to listen carefully to what others are saying and to respond in a way that shows you understand and value their perspective. Relationships are built on trust, and trust is built on consistent, reliable, honest behavior. Negotiating Deals with Confidence

Negotiating deals with confidence involves a fundamental understanding of the value that one brings to the table. It is not just about the price or terms, but also about the value proposition, the worthiness of the product or service, and the credibility of the person or company offering it. Harnessing the Power of Social Media

Harnessing the power of social media is primarily about understanding the channels available and how best to utilize them. It involves identifying your target audience and determining which social media platforms they use most. Once these platforms are identified, you should then establish your presence on them by creating engaging and relevant content.
